Output faa2ae3db60c4bf9a5c576bf68ec64880aef5a7614ca4e6e50fc4692f8fdb98e:3

value
2179814
script pubkey
OP_0 OP_PUSHBYTES_20 da9e7e86b1d92eb537584857ceb4a8c8e1b38e9a
address
bc1qm208ap43myht2d6cfptuad9gersm8r566x54q4
transaction
faa2ae3db60c4bf9a5c576bf68ec64880aef5a7614ca4e6e50fc4692f8fdb98e
confirmations
128565
spent
false